If you’re over the age of 55 and your pension pot is £10,000 or less, it may be classed as a ‘small pension pot’. In these circumstances, you can take the whole of your pension as cash, whether your pension is defined contribution or final salary (defined benefit).

The Department for Work and Pensions has said those under pension credit age who choose to withdraw money from their pension pots, will have it taken into account when applying for means-tested benefits.
